Reno seeks revenge on Bush brother in Florida
FROM ROLAND WATSON IN WASHINGTON
An excerpt
The prospect of her candidature is worrying some local Democrat leaders, who fear that her record as the first woman Attorney-General will bring unwanted Clintonite baggage to the contest.
Ms Reno heavily outscores her Democrat rivals on name recognition, according to the latest polls in Florida, but such a lead is double-edged. She is vilified among the large Cuban population for her role in the fate of Elián González, the six-year-old shipwrecked refugee who was caught in a custody dispute between his father in Cuba and his Miami relatives. Ms Renos decision to authorise a raid on their house and send the boy back to Cuba was taken in the teeth of aggressive opposition from the Hispanic population.
She is also remembered across the nation for ordering the catastrophic assault on the Branch Davidian compound in Waco, Texas, in 1993. Such episodes have some local Republican leaders keenly awaiting a Reno candidature. They point to polls taken in August that suggest that she could expect to secure the Democratic nomination, but would lose to Governor Bush, despite a slide in his popularity.
Before she can concentrate on an electoral battle with Mr Bush, Ms Reno, 63, has the Democratic primary to negotiate. Other likely contenders include Peter Paterson, a former congressman and former US Ambassador to Vietnam, a country where he was a prisoner of war.
